The World Baseball Classic quarterfinal between USA and Canada is set to be a thrilling encounter. Team USA, despite early struggles, has shown offensive firepower, while Canada has demonstrated resilience and strong team play.
**Team USA:**
After a surprising loss to Italy, Team USA secured its spot in the quarterfinals thanks to Italy's win against Mexico. The team's offense is a major strength, but their pitching has been inconsistent. Logan Webb, the expected starting pitcher, will need to be sharp to contain Canada's lineup.
**Team Canada:**
Canada's path to the quarterfinals was marked by solid wins and a close loss. Their roster features major-league talent, with Owen Caissie being a standout performer. Michael Soroka, the starting pitcher, will need to bring his best game to keep Canada in contention.

**Predictions:**
While Team USA is the favorite, Canada is expected to put up a strong fight. Predictions suggest a close game, with Canada potentially covering the +4.5 run line. Key to Canada's chances is the performance of Owen Caissie, who has been a standout hitter in the tournament.
